Looks like the difference in price between a balcony and mini is almost $900 PP. I would jump at a chance to upgrade to a mini for $250 PP. It's just not having a bathtub. The bathroom is twice as big as a normal balcony if not a bit bigger. You also have a larger living area with a sofa. Almost like having two small rooms to spend time in. The mini's are extremely comfortable for longer cruises. But to each his own. Enjoy your balcony stateroom

I love a mini suite - A welcome glass of champagne, much larger bathroom, extra lounge space to relax and a sofa, upgraded amenities (robes, pillows, mattresses), plus some little bits here and there I am sure. We pay just for the extra space in the living area and a decent sized bathroom. Well worth $250 upgrade!

 

But each to their own, and what they value or regards as value. I wish I had that offer!
